Understanding Homes for Sale: What Buyers Need to Know

When searching for homes for sale, buyers are looking for properties that meet their budget, lifestyle, and long-term goals. A home for sale is simply any residential property available on the market for purchase, ranging from single-family houses and condominiums to townhomes and multi-family units. According to the National Association of Realtors, the average homebuyer now spends about 10 weeks looking for the right property, highlighting the importance of a strategic approach to this process.

From a developer’s perspective, understanding the nuances of the housing market—such as local demand, price trends, and neighborhood growth—can make a significant difference in finding value and potential appreciation.

Key Factors Influencing the Search for Homes

Several critical elements affect how buyers approach the market for homes for sale. These include:

  • Location: Proximity to schools, workplaces, amenities, and transportation influences property desirability.
  • Price Range: Aligning budget with realistic expectations helps narrow down options efficiently.
  • Property Type: Different buyers prefer varied home styles, such as detached houses or apartments.
  • Market Conditions: Sellers’ market versus buyers’ market impacts negotiation power and pricing.
  • Inspection and Condition: Evaluating a home’s structural integrity and necessary repairs is crucial before purchase.

Understanding these factors equips buyers to make informed decisions and avoid common pitfalls.

The Role of Technology in Finding Homes for Sale

In today’s digital age, searching for homes has become more accessible and transparent. Online listings, virtual tours, and real-time market data allow buyers to vet properties before scheduling in-person visits. Real estate platforms aggregate information on available homes for sale, offering filters for location, price, size, and features.

Many users observe that homes for sale listings provide detailed insights that help streamline the buying process, reducing time spent on unsuitable options. This technology-driven approach complements traditional methods by bringing efficiency and clarity to the property search.

How Real Estate Agents Enhance the Buying Experience

While buyers can explore homes independently, partnering with a skilled real estate agent often yields better outcomes. Agents bring expertise in market trends, negotiation strategies, and legal complexities, protecting clients’ interests throughout the transaction. According to industry experts, working with an agent can result in securing a home for a competitive price and avoiding costly errors.

Agents also have access to exclusive listings and network connections, expanding buyers’ options beyond public databases. Their guidance on paperwork and closing procedures ensures a smoother, faster purchase.

Financing and Affordability Considerations

Securing financing is a critical step when purchasing homes for sale. Mortgage rates, loan types, and credit qualifications vary widely, directly impacting buyers’ purchasing power. Consulting with mortgage professionals early in the process helps establish clear budgets and pre-approval status, which strengthens offers in competitive markets.

Affordability isn’t only about the purchase price; buyers must factor in property taxes, insurance, maintenance, and utilities. Comprehensive financial planning is essential to avoid overextension and enjoy homeownership sustainably.
